Theoretical and empirical approaches to fiscal policy: evidence from the Superbonus 110% in Italy

Aletti Montano, Bianca (A.A. 2024/2025) Theoretical and empirical approaches to fiscal policy: evidence from the Superbonus 110% in Italy. Tesi di Laurea in Macroeconomics, Luiss Guido Carli, relatore Francesco Lippi, pp. 49. [Bachelor's Degree Thesis]

Abstract/Index

Role of fiscal stimulus in macroeconomic theory. Definition of fiscal stimulus. Role of public spending in macroeconomic equilibrium. Theoretical perspectives on fiscal stimulus. Estimation of fiscal multipliers. Size, determinants and use of fiscal multipliers in macroeconomic projections. Impact of fiscal multipliers in recessions and expansions. Output responses to fiscal policy. Self financing fiscal policy. The Superbonus 110% Italian Policy. Origins and rationale behind the policy. Implementation mechanisms. Impact of Superbonus 110%. Unintended consequences. Policy lessons and recommendations.
